Thyroid Hormone Status in Sitosterolemia Is Modified by Ezetimibe.

Ezetimibe (EZE) treatment for sitosterolemia reduced 5α-stanols and improved thyroid hormone biomarkers, specifically increasing the free thyroxine to free triiodothyronine ratio (FT3/FT4). This suggests EZE may positively impact thyroid function in these patients.
Area of Science:
- Endocrinology
- Metabolic Disorders
- Pharmacology
Background:
- Sitosterolemia is a rare genetic disorder characterized by the accumulation of plant sterols.
- Thyroid hormone status can be influenced by various metabolic factors.
- Ezetimibe (EZE) is a cholesterol absorption inhibitor with potential effects on sterol metabolism.
Purpose of the Study:
- To investigate the relationship between thyroid status biomarkers and 5α-stanols in patients with sitosterolemia.
- To evaluate the impact of ezetimibe (EZE) treatment on these biomarkers.
Main Methods:
- A study involving eight patients with sitosterolemia over 28 weeks (14 weeks off EZE, 14 weeks on EZE 10 mg/day).
- Measurement of serum thyroid biomarkers (FT3, FT4, FT3/FT4 ratio, TSH) and 5α-stanols (sitostanol, cholestanol).
- Assessment of cholestanol precursors including total cholesterol and lathosterol.
Main Results:
- Ezetimibe (EZE) significantly reduced plasma and red blood cell levels of sitostanol and cholestanol.
- EZE treatment led to a significant increase in the free triiodothyronine to free thyroxine ratio (FT3/FT4).
- The reduction in plasma cholestanol inversely correlated with the increase in FT3/FT4.
Conclusions:
- 5α-stanols levels in sitosterolemia patients may be linked to thyroid function.
- Ezetimibe (EZE) reduces circulating 5α-stanols and enhances the FT3/FT4 ratio.
- These findings suggest EZE may improve thyroid hormone status by increasing T4 to T3 conversion.
